It’s a sad day in Hollywood as Director/Producer/Actor Sydney Pollack has lost his battle with cancer. He was 73. First diagnosed nine months ago, Pollack died Monday night surrounded by friends and family.

With a film career spanning more than 4 decades, the list of movies either produced, directed or in which he appeared as an actor is staggering. More than 70 movies either produced, directed or acted in, including classics and hits like;
- They Shoot Horses, Don’t They? (1969)
- Jeremiah Johnson (1972)
- The Way We Were (1973)
- The Yakuza (1975)
- Honeysuckle Rose (1980)
- Absence of Malice (1981)
- Tootsie (1982)
- Out of Africa (1985)
- Bright Lights, Big City (1988)
- The Fabulous Baker Boys (1989)
- Major League (1989)
- White Palace (1990)
- Presumed Innocent (1990)
- Havana (1990)
- King Ralph (1991)
- The Player (1992)
- Husbands and Wives (1992)
- Death Becomes Her (1992)
- The Firm (1993)
- Searching for Bobby Fischer (1993)
- Sense and Sensibility (1995)
- Sabrina (1995)
- A Civil Action (1998)
- Sliding Doors (1998)
- The Talented Mr. Ripley (1999)
- Random Hearts (1999)
- Eyes Wide Shut (1999)
- The Majestic (2001)
- Birthday Girl (2002)
- Changing Lanes (2002)
- Cold Mountain (2003)
- The Interpreter (2005)
- Michael Clayton (2007)
- Leatherheads (2008)
- Made of Honor (2008)
